Output 79c66c40fe3d86b1df676c2229f1727afc20fdba2e08ddc39f1d58ec97809ad9:0

value
15840667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e13773ff08ba0acaacef17668954af7a0a09eb1 OP_EQUAL
address
MLrPWBLEwsU8yUXJMNvETPSY2Zi1cb1QoX
transaction
79c66c40fe3d86b1df676c2229f1727afc20fdba2e08ddc39f1d58ec97809ad9
spent
true